Polak,

Any worries about your decals fading over time? I might be interested in the brake light decal. Thanks.
Old May 7, 2004 | 01:45 PM
  #21  
PoLaK's Avatar
Son what is your Alibi?
iTrader: (1)
 
Joined: Sep 2002
Posts: 2,205
Likes: 2
From: Washington, DC
I warranty them for one year for colorfastness so no worries. Avery quotes them for 3 years and they are fully removable.
